Cleveland Browns Make Major Quarterback Shift: Dillon Gabriel to Start
The Cleveland Browns are making headlines with a surprising decision to bench veteran quarterback Joe Flacco in favor of rookie Dillon Gabriel for their upcoming matchup against the Minnesota Vikings on Sunday. This change comes ahead of their Week 5 clash at the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ium in London.
Key Changes in the Depth Chart
- Dillon Gabriel: Promoted to starter, Gabriel, a third-round draft pick, will make his first career start against the Vikings.
- Joe Flacco: The veteran quarterback will move to the backup role after struggling to perform this season.
- Shedeur Sanders: The rookie remains as QB3, continuing to learn the ropes while observing from the sidelines.
Reaction to the Transition
When questioned about the quarterback switch and his own position on the team, Sanders opted for silence, humorously pantomiming his responses rather than offering a verbal comment. This response comes after he made waves last week by claiming he was “ready to play now” and felt capable of performing better than several established NFL starters.
Coach’s Diplomatic Remarks
Cleveland’s head coach Kevin Stefanski weighed in on Sanders’ earlier comments, expressing a belief that all players, including rookies, should feel prepared:
“I hope all of our guys feel like they’re ready… We do a lot of work with our players, spending every available minute to get them ready physically and mentally,” Stefanski stated.
Shedeur Sanders: A Developing Talent
Despite his recent comments, Shedeur Sanders remains focused on his development and the experience he is gaining as part of the Browns’ scout team. In a recent interview, he expressed gratitude for his situation:
- Competitive Environment: “It’s fun going out there and competing every day.”
- Personal Growth: Sanders emphasized the importance of gaining a new perspective and growing both mentally and emotionally during his time with the team.
“I know at the end of the day I’m getting closer to where I want to be,” he added, reflecting optimism about his future.
